Corporate social responsibility (CSR) is a business approach that involves companies taking responsibility for their impact on society and the environment. It goes beyond simply maximizing profits and instead focuses on creating a positive impact on the community, employees, customers, and the environment. This includes ethical business practices, philanthropy, and sustainable initiatives. Companies that practice CSR strive to balance their economic goals with their social and environmental responsibilities, ultimately contributing to the betterment of society as a whole. By incorporating CSR into their operations, companies can build trust and credibility with stakeholders, enhance their reputation, and create a more sustainable and equitable future for all.
